right chris.... if you look at the strut then on the inside of the strut near the top there's a link what goes down to the antiroll bar (goes across the front of the car) that is the drop link

I think you may mean anti-rollbar drop links?
They are on the ends of the rollbar and join it to the chassis each end has the same bearing that’s fitted to track rods.
